Reason to look forward to this afternoon’s gold medal Tennis match with optimism.

Age – Murray is younger than Federer and Federer, despite his world #1 ranking, is in decline. Just very gradual and from a very high peak. Murray is approaching his peak and when players peak anything is possible. Both players are on the process of converging.

Format – Murray got of to a great start at Wimbledon and flew out of the blocks before Federer used his experience and skill to grind him down. If Murray can boss the game then he stands a chance. The change of format from a three to a five set match in the final (thanks for the correction) should help the younger player, but as we saw in Wimbledon Federer used his experiance to frustrate Murray. Would have prefered a best of three in the final but historically longer matches favour younger players.

Psychology – Nothing like the prospect of revenge to ignite some passion. A passionate crowd and momentum from events elsewhere will add to the feel good factor. Worth a few points and some inspiration. The crowd is going to be very noisy today!

OK, so I’ve laid out possibles there and a it’s a bit partisan but I’d rank success as a definite possible today, upgraded from ‘not completely impossible’ at Wimbledon. Would have prefered not to see the change in format for the final. Federer has a great grass game, but maybe, just maybe, Murray can use everything in his favour today.
